The investigation into the kidnapping of Nancy Guthrie just gained a new layer of intrigue. Authorities have detained at least three individuals, and one particularly notable photo has surfaced of a man in handcuffs, caught in the act during a traffic stop in Tucson, Arizona. This isn’t just any traffic stop; it’s unfolding just two miles from Guthrie’s home, raising questions about the connection between the incident and her mysterious abduction.

On February 1, Guthrie was taken from her home, and since then, law enforcement has been tirelessly searching for leads. The recently detained individuals were scrutinized after Pima County deputies pulled over a Range Rover near a Culver’s restaurant. While one man was released after being questioned, the whereabouts of Guthrie remain uncertain, and the community is left holding its breath for answers.

The stakes keep growing as the FBI also jumps into the mix, having released footage of a potential suspect lurking at Guthrie’s front door in the days leading up to her abduction.
